Aluminium, Commercial Alloy
2011 T6 Bar
High mechanical strength alloy that machines exceptionally well.
Often called a free machining alloy or ‘FMA’ it is well suited to use in automatic lathes.

Proprietà
Composizione chimica
Alloy 2011
| Elemento Chimico | % Presente |
| Ferro (Fe) | 0.00 - 0.70 |
| Rame (Cu) | 5.00 - 6.00 |
| Lead (Pb) | 0.20 - 0.40 |
| Bismuth (Bi) | 0.20 - 0.60 |
| Other (Each) | 0.00 - 0.05 |
| Others (Total) | 0.00 - 0.15 |
| Silicio (Si) | 0.00 - 0.40 |
| Zinc (Zn) | 0.00 - 0.30 |
| Aluminium (Al) | Equilibrio |
Proprietà Meccaniche
Rod and Bar Up to 75mm Dia.
| Proprietà meccaniche | Valore |
| Allungamento A50 mm | 6 Min % |
| Resistenza alla trazione | 310 Min MPa |
| Tensione di snervamento | 230 Min MPa |
| Durezza Brinell | 110 HB |
| Elongation A | 8 Min % |

Proprietà fisiche generali
| Proprietà fisica | Valore |
| Densità | 2.83 g/cm³ |
| Modulo di elasticità | 70 GPa |
| Dilatazione termica | 22.9 x 10-6/K |
| Punto di fusione | 535 °C |
Applicazioni
- 2011 is typically used in applications that require parts manufactured by repetition machining. These applications may include:
- Appliance parts & trim
- Automotive trim
- Fasteners and fittings
- Ordnance
Characteristics
- Machining at high speeds produces fine chips that are easily removed. The excellent machining characteristics allow the production of complex and detailed parts. In some circumstances 2011 can replace free machining brass without the need for alterations to tooling.
- It has poor corrosion resistance, which means parts made from 2011 tend to be anodised to provide additional surface protection.
- Alloy 2011 has extremely poor weldability and thus welding is not recommended. However, as it is used for machined parts there is rarely a need to weld this alloy.
